A Science regarding Cleanliness: What Cleanrooms Work
Cleanrooms are a fascinating illustration of applied engineering, designed to maintain incredibly minimal levels of dust. Unlike typical spaces, their performance copyrights on a complex combination of filtration, circulation, and meticulous cleaning protocols. Initially, air is pulled into the cleanroom through HEPA screens, which effectively remove particles larger than 0.3 microns. Subsequently, the filtered air is distributed throughout the space in a carefully controlled unidirectional airflow, pushing impurities toward exhaust vents. Moreover, strict guidelines govern staff access, requiring them to wear specialized clothing so as minimize shedding of skin particles and other possible causes of impurity. In essence, a cleanroom is an contained environment where ambient factors are rigorously controlled for critical processes.
